The Clivus Multrum™ composting tank is formed in UV-resistant rotomoulded
polyethylene and the tank is internally divided into a waste chamber and
finished compost chamber.
The waste chamber is supplied with stainless steel front baffle & air ducts and
a polyethylene rear air baffle.
An inspection door at the front of the chamber also facilitates maintenance of
the compost pile.
The finished compost chamber at the front of the tank is fitted with a full-width
access lid to permit easy removal of compost.
A drain fitting is provided in the finished compost chamber to permit draining
of any excess liquid end product. An air inlet vent with insect screen is also
provided in this compartment.
All fasteners are of stainless steel. Other minor fittings are of corrosion
resistant materials.
All tank models may be partially buried to a depth not greater than the
access door flange at the front of the tank.
The nominal daily and annual capacities assume an annual mean temperature
of 18°C or above. Actual capacity reduces with temperature and below an
annual mean of 13°C the use of natural heating and/or worms may be required.
